ReelIsraelDC: Screening of Israeli Film "The Little Traitor"





Based on the novel "Panther in the Basement" by the world-renowned author, Amos Oz, "The Little Traitor" takes place in Palestine in 1947, just a few months before Israel becomes a state. Proffy Liebowitz, a militant yet sensitive eleven year old wants nothing more than for the occupying British to get the hell out of his land. Proffy and his two friends spend most of their time plotting ways to terrorize and/or blow up the British until one evening, while he's out after curfew, Proffy is seized by Sergeant Dunlop, a British officer. Instead of arresting him, he deposits him back home, but what ensues in the weeks to come is a friendship between these two foes.
